- PublicaciónAcceso abiertoDiseño del programa de alta hospitalaria como indicador de institución segura para el cuidador y paciente con hipertensión arterial y diabetes mellitus en una institución de segundo nivel en la Guajira(Bucaramanga : Universidad de Santander, 2019, 2019-04-05) Polanco Carrillo, Margarita M.; Campos de Aldana, María-StellaStudies have reflected the increase in chronic noncommunicable diseases, including hypertension and diabetes mellitus, being a national and international public health problem. Patients and their caregivers should strive to provide a program where these indicators are minimized. The objective to go design the high hospital program as an indicator of a safe institution for the caregiver and patient with arterial hypertension and diabetes mellitus in a second level institution in La Guajira. The methodology of this study was to approach quantitative, descriptive, analytical cross-sectional approach. The population were patients with arterial hypertension and / or Diabetes Mellitus, who attended the program "Hypertensive Club" for the design of the program and the development of the strategies to implement, first a pilot test was carried out. Results: in patients it was found that the predominant sex was female (58%), the median age was 60, the average time with chronic disease was 9.32 (SD ± 7.6) years and with a single caregiver; in conditions of the socio-demographic profile of the caregiver, the female gender predominated, with age between 22 - 78 years. The chronic disease is characterized by increasing and staying on time; the global guidelines emphasize the importance of guaranteeing continuity, safety and comprehensiveness, education, guidance and follow-up towards the recognition and management of pathology. Research on the management of health services, in order to generate proposals and / or programs based on scientific evidence, can improve the provision of nursing care and have a positive impact on the different indicators of morbidity and mortality, time of hospital stay, preventable readmissions, user satisfaction among some other existing indicators.
- PublicaciónRestringidoPropuesta de mejora al sistema de indicadores del área de acondicionamiento de PROCAPS BOGOTÁ.(Cúcuta: Universidad de Sántander, 2018, 2018-12-15) Urbina Peinado, Gerardo Alfonso.; Miranda Yañez, Jose Daniel.In this project, the Balance Scorecard design was carried out in the conditioning area of Procaps Bogotá, in which the 4 indicators that would be measured and evaluated in that statistical and measurement system were identified and designed, studying the current needs of the area and its shortcomings, these 4 indicators are: the productive level, absenteeism, non-conformities, and disciplinary and safety processes. Together with the design of the indicators, their collection formats were generated in order to have real and concrete data that can give a real diagnosis of the area, in addition to this, improvements were made in the process such as the creation of a commitment format and Disciplinary guidelines for compliance, which without the full implementation of the Balance Scorecard have begun to show improvements at the productive level due to the monitoring and actions taken with the results found. The Balance Scorecard is finalized in its design and ready for its implementation being endorsed by the coordinator of the areas, and the head of operations of the company, presenting notable improvements at the productive level since before its implementation, is a guarantee for the optimization of the area.
